Every year, the Old Florida Celebration of the Arts in Cedar Key selects a piece of art to become the design motif for the festival’s posters, postcards and T-shirts. This year, that honor was awarded to mosaic artist Valerie Bretl for her stunning and deeply felt mosaic depicting the icons and lore of the historic shellmounds just outside Cedar Key. Using hand-made tile, Valerie captured the birds, tides, sea grass and Native American spirit whose ancestors created the mounds millenniums ago.
